Antique Silver-Plated Food Warmer by Walker & Hall, Sheffield – circa 1900

Elegant and rare antique silver-plated food warmer (entrée dish warmer) produced by the renowned English silversmith Walker & Hall (Sheffield), dating to approximately 1890–1920.

This refined piece features a beautifully domed lid, a removable inner bowl, and an elevated stand designed to accommodate a spirit burner (not included). The warmer is decorated in a classic style, with clean lines and subtle detailing typical of high-quality English tableware from the late Victorian / Edwardian period.

The interior of the lid is engraved with a crest and the name “J. Esper”, suggesting it may have originally belonged to a private household or fine dining establishment, adding historical character and uniqueness.

Condition:
Good antique condition with typical signs of age and use. Minor wear to the silver plating, especially on the underside and interior, consistent with age. No major dents or damage. The piece displays very well.

Dimensions (approx.):
Height: 18 cm
Diameter: 13 cm

Notes:
• Fully functional as a serving piece, though the original spirit burner is not included
• Ideal as a decorative collectible or for stylish table presentation

A fine example of English silver-plated craftsmanship, perfect for collectors or lovers of antique tableware.
